    1 // SPDX-License-Identifier: (GPL-2.0+ OR MIT)
    2 /*
    3  * Copyright (C) 2015 Freescale Semiconductor, Inc.
    4  * Copyright (C) 2019 reMarkable AS - http://www.remarkable.com/
    5  *
    6  */
    7 
    8 /dts-v1/;
    9 
   10 #include "imx7d.dtsi"
   11 
   12 / {
   13         model = "reMarkable 2.0";
   14         compatible = "remarkable,imx7d-remarkable2", "fsl,imx7d";
   15 
   16         chosen {
   17                 stdout-path = &uart6;
   18         };
   19 
   20         memory@80000000 {
   21                 device_type = "memory";
   22                 reg = <0x80000000 0x40000000>;
   23         };
   24 
   25         reg_brcm: regulator-brcm {
   26                 compatible = "regulator-fixed";
   27                 regulator-name = "brcm_reg";
   28                 regulator-min-microvolt = <3300000>;
   29                 regulator-max-microvolt = <3300000>;
   30                 pinctrl-names = "default";
   31                 pinctrl-0 = <&pinctrl_brcm_reg>;
   32                 gpio = <&gpio6 13 GPIO_ACTIVE_HIGH>;
   33                 enable-active-high;
   34                 startup-delay-us = <150>;
   35         };
   36 
   37         reg_digitizer: regulator-digitizer {
   38                 compatible = "regulator-fixed";
   39                 regulator-name = "VDD_3V3_DIGITIZER";
   40                 regulator-min-microvolt = <3300000>;
   41                 regulator-max-microvolt = <3300000>;
   42                 pinctrl-names = "default", "sleep";
   43                 pinctrl-0 = <&pinctrl_digitizer_reg>;
   44                 pinctrl-1 = <&pinctrl_digitizer_reg>;
   45                 gpio = <&gpio1 6 GPIO_ACTIVE_HIGH>;
   46                 enable-active-high;
   47                 startup-delay-us = <100000>; /* 100 ms */
   48         };
   49 
   50         wifi_pwrseq: wifi_pwrseq {
   51                 compatible = "mmc-pwrseq-simple";
   52                 pinctrl-names = "default";
   53                 pinctrl-0 = <&pinctrl_wifi>;
   54                 reset-gpios = <&gpio5 9 GPIO_ACTIVE_LOW>;
   55                 clocks = <&clks IMX7D_CLKO2_ROOT_DIV>;
   56                 clock-names = "ext_clock";
   57         };
   58 };
   59 
   60 &clks {
   61         assigned-clocks = <&clks IMX7D_CLKO2_ROOT_SRC>,
   62                           <&clks IMX7D_CLKO2_ROOT_DIV>;
   63         assigned-clock-parents = <&clks IMX7D_CKIL>;
   64         assigned-clock-rates = <0>, <32768>;
   65 };
   66 
   67 &i2c1 {
   68         clock-frequency = <400000>;
   69         pinctrl-names = "default";
   70         pinctrl-0 = <&pinctrl_i2c1>;
   71         status = "okay";
   72 
   73         wacom_digitizer: digitizer@9 {
   74                 compatible = "hid-over-i2c";
   75                 reg = <0x09>;
   76                 hid-descr-addr = <0x01>;
   77                 pinctrl-names = "default";
   78                 pinctrl-0 = <&pinctrl_wacom>;
   79                 interrupt-parent = <&gpio1>;
   80                 interrupts = <1 IRQ_TYPE_LEVEL_LOW>;
   81                 touchscreen-inverted-x;
   82                 touchscreen-inverted-y;
   83                 vdd-supply = <&reg_digitizer>;
   84         };
   85 };
   86 
   87 &snvs_pwrkey {
   88         status = "okay";
   89 };
   90 
   91 &uart1 {
   92         pinctrl-names = "default";
   93         pinctrl-0 = <&pinctrl_uart1>;
   94         assigned-clocks = <&clks IMX7D_UART1_ROOT_SRC>;
   95         assigned-clock-parents = <&clks IMX7D_OSC_24M_CLK>;
   96         status = "okay";
   97 };
   98 
   99 &uart6 {
  100         pinctrl-names = "default";
  101         pinctrl-0 = <&pinctrl_uart6>;
  102         assigned-clocks = <&clks IMX7D_UART6_ROOT_SRC>;
  103         assigned-clock-parents = <&clks IMX7D_OSC_24M_CLK>;
  104         status = "okay";
  105 };
  106 
  107 &usbotg2 {
  108         srp-disable;
  109         hnp-disable;
  110         status = "okay";
  111 };
  112 
  113 &usdhc2 {
  114         #address-cells = <1>;
  115         #size-cells = <0>;
  116         pinctrl-names = "default", "state_100mhz", "state_200mhz", "sleep";
  117         pinctrl-0 = <&pinctrl_usdhc2>;
  118         pinctrl-1 = <&pinctrl_usdhc2_100mhz>;
  119         pinctrl-2 = <&pinctrl_usdhc2_200mhz>;
  120         mmc-pwrseq = <&wifi_pwrseq>;
  121         vmmc-supply = <&reg_brcm>;
  122         bus-width = <4>;
  123         non-removable;
  124         keep-power-in-suspend;
  125         cap-power-off-card;
  126         status = "okay";
  127 
  128         brcmf: bcrmf@1 {
  129                 reg = <1>;
  130                 compatible = "brcm,bcm4329-fmac";
  131         };
  132 };
  133 
  134 &usdhc3 {
  135         pinctrl-names = "default", "state_100mhz", "state_200mhz", "sleep";
  136         pinctrl-0 = <&pinctrl_usdhc3>;
  137         pinctrl-1 = <&pinctrl_usdhc3_100mhz>;
  138         pinctrl-2 = <&pinctrl_usdhc3_200mhz>;
  139         pinctrl-3 = <&pinctrl_usdhc3>;
  140         assigned-clocks = <&clks IMX7D_USDHC3_ROOT_CLK>;
  141         assigned-clock-rates = <400000000>;
  142         bus-width = <8>;
  143         non-removable;
  144         status = "okay";
  145 };
  146 
  147 &wdog1 {
  148         pinctrl-names = "default";
  149         pinctrl-0 = <&pinctrl_wdog>;
  150         fsl,ext-reset-output;
  151 };
  152 
  153 &iomuxc_lpsr {
  154         pinctrl_digitizer_reg: digitizerreggrp {
  155                 fsl,pins = <
  156                         /* DIGITIZER_PWR_EN */
  157                         MX7D_PAD_LPSR_GPIO1_IO06__GPIO1_IO6     0x14
  158                 >;
  159         };
  160 
  161         pinctrl_wacom: wacomgrp {
  162                 fsl,pins = <
  163                         /*MX7D_PAD_LPSR_GPIO1_IO05__GPIO1_IO5   0x00000014 FWE */
  164                         MX7D_PAD_LPSR_GPIO1_IO04__GPIO1_IO4     0x00000074 /* PDCTB */
  165                         MX7D_PAD_LPSR_GPIO1_IO01__GPIO1_IO1     0x00000034 /* WACOM INT */
  166                         /*MX7D_PAD_LPSR_GPIO1_IO06__GPIO1_IO6   0x00000014 WACOM PWR ENABLE */
  167                         /*MX7D_PAD_LPSR_GPIO1_IO00__GPIO1_IO0   0x00000074 WACOM RESET */
  168                 >;
  169         };
  170 };
  171 
  172 &iomuxc {
  173         pinctrl_brcm_reg: brcmreggrp {
  174                 fsl,pins = <
  175                         /* WIFI_PWR_EN */
  176                         MX7D_PAD_SAI1_TX_BCLK__GPIO6_IO13       0x14
  177                 >;
  178         };
  179 
  180         pinctrl_i2c1: i2c1grp {
  181                 fsl,pins = <
  182                         MX7D_PAD_I2C1_SDA__I2C1_SDA             0x4000007f
  183                         MX7D_PAD_I2C1_SCL__I2C1_SCL             0x4000007f
  184                 >;
  185         };
  186 
  187         pinctrl_uart1: uart1grp {
  188                 fsl,pins = <
  189                         MX7D_PAD_UART1_TX_DATA__UART1_DCE_TX    0x79
  190                         MX7D_PAD_UART1_RX_DATA__UART1_DCE_RX    0x79
  191                 >;
  192         };
  193 
  194         pinctrl_uart6: uart6grp {
  195                 fsl,pins = <
  196                         MX7D_PAD_EPDC_DATA09__UART6_DCE_TX              0x79
  197                         MX7D_PAD_EPDC_DATA08__UART6_DCE_RX              0x79
  198                 >;
  199         };
  200 
  201         pinctrl_usdhc2: usdhc2grp {
  202                 fsl,pins = <
  203                         MX7D_PAD_SD2_CMD__SD2_CMD               0x59
  204                         MX7D_PAD_SD2_CLK__SD2_CLK               0x19
  205                         MX7D_PAD_SD2_DATA0__SD2_DATA0           0x59
  206                         MX7D_PAD_SD2_DATA1__SD2_DATA1           0x59
  207                         MX7D_PAD_SD2_DATA2__SD2_DATA2           0x59
  208                         MX7D_PAD_SD2_DATA3__SD2_DATA3           0x59
  209                 >;
  210         };
  211 
  212         pinctrl_usdhc2_100mhz: usdhc2grp_100mhz {
  213                 fsl,pins = <
  214                         MX7D_PAD_SD2_CMD__SD2_CMD               0x5a
  215                         MX7D_PAD_SD2_CLK__SD2_CLK               0x1a
  216                         MX7D_PAD_SD2_DATA0__SD2_DATA0           0x5a
  217                         MX7D_PAD_SD2_DATA1__SD2_DATA1           0x5a
  218                         MX7D_PAD_SD2_DATA2__SD2_DATA2           0x5a
  219                         MX7D_PAD_SD2_DATA3__SD2_DATA3           0x5a
  220                 >;
  221         };
  222 
  223         pinctrl_usdhc2_200mhz: usdhc2grp_200mhz {
  224                 fsl,pins = <
  225                         MX7D_PAD_SD2_CMD__SD2_CMD               0x5b
  226                         MX7D_PAD_SD2_CLK__SD2_CLK               0x1b
  227                         MX7D_PAD_SD2_DATA0__SD2_DATA0           0x5b
  228                         MX7D_PAD_SD2_DATA1__SD2_DATA1           0x5b
  229                         MX7D_PAD_SD2_DATA2__SD2_DATA2           0x5b
  230                         MX7D_PAD_SD2_DATA3__SD2_DATA3           0x5b
  231                 >;
  232         };
  233 
  234         pinctrl_usdhc3: usdhc3grp {
  235                 fsl,pins = <
  236                         MX7D_PAD_SD3_CMD__SD3_CMD               0x59
  237                         MX7D_PAD_SD3_CLK__SD3_CLK               0x19
  238                         MX7D_PAD_SD3_DATA0__SD3_DATA0           0x59
  239                         MX7D_PAD_SD3_DATA1__SD3_DATA1           0x59
  240                         MX7D_PAD_SD3_DATA2__SD3_DATA2           0x59
  241                         MX7D_PAD_SD3_DATA3__SD3_DATA3           0x59
  242                         MX7D_PAD_SD3_DATA4__SD3_DATA4           0x59
  243                         MX7D_PAD_SD3_DATA5__SD3_DATA5           0x59
  244                         MX7D_PAD_SD3_DATA6__SD3_DATA6           0x59
  245                         MX7D_PAD_SD3_DATA7__SD3_DATA7           0x59
  246                         MX7D_PAD_SD3_STROBE__SD3_STROBE         0x19
  247                 >;
  248         };
  249 
  250         pinctrl_usdhc3_100mhz: usdhc3grp_100mhz {
  251                 fsl,pins = <
  252                         MX7D_PAD_SD3_CMD__SD3_CMD               0x5a
  253                         MX7D_PAD_SD3_CLK__SD3_CLK               0x1a
  254                         MX7D_PAD_SD3_DATA0__SD3_DATA0           0x5a
  255                         MX7D_PAD_SD3_DATA1__SD3_DATA1           0x5a
  256                         MX7D_PAD_SD3_DATA2__SD3_DATA2           0x5a
  257                         MX7D_PAD_SD3_DATA3__SD3_DATA3           0x5a
  258                         MX7D_PAD_SD3_DATA4__SD3_DATA4           0x5a
  259                         MX7D_PAD_SD3_DATA5__SD3_DATA5           0x5a
  260                         MX7D_PAD_SD3_DATA6__SD3_DATA6           0x5a
  261                         MX7D_PAD_SD3_DATA7__SD3_DATA7           0x5a
  262                         MX7D_PAD_SD3_STROBE__SD3_STROBE         0x1a
  263                 >;
  264         };
  265 
  266         pinctrl_usdhc3_200mhz: usdhc3grp_200mhz {
  267                 fsl,pins = <
  268                         MX7D_PAD_SD3_CMD__SD3_CMD               0x5b
  269                         MX7D_PAD_SD3_CLK__SD3_CLK               0x1b
  270                         MX7D_PAD_SD3_DATA0__SD3_DATA0           0x5b
  271                         MX7D_PAD_SD3_DATA1__SD3_DATA1           0x5b
  272                         MX7D_PAD_SD3_DATA2__SD3_DATA2           0x5b
  273                         MX7D_PAD_SD3_DATA3__SD3_DATA3           0x5b
  274                         MX7D_PAD_SD3_DATA4__SD3_DATA4           0x5b
  275                         MX7D_PAD_SD3_DATA5__SD3_DATA5           0x5b
  276                         MX7D_PAD_SD3_DATA6__SD3_DATA6           0x5b
  277                         MX7D_PAD_SD3_DATA7__SD3_DATA7           0x5b
  278                         MX7D_PAD_SD3_STROBE__SD3_STROBE         0x1b
  279                 >;
  280         };
  281 
  282         pinctrl_wdog: wdoggrp {
  283                 fsl,pins = <
  284                         MX7D_PAD_ENET1_COL__WDOG1_WDOG_ANY      0x74
  285                 >;
  286         };
  287 
  288         pinctrl_wifi: wifigrp {
  289                 fsl,pins = <
  290                         /* WiFi Reg On */
  291                         MX7D_PAD_SD2_CD_B__GPIO5_IO9            0x00000014
  292                         /* WiFi Sleep 32k */
  293                         MX7D_PAD_SD1_WP__CCM_CLKO2              0x00000014
  294                 >;
  295         };
  296 };
